Full Description
Cast iron milepost, inscribed 'Derby 4 miles'. Iron cast by J. Harrison, who traded from 47 Bridgegate, Derby from about 1820-1855. (1)
The milepost is an early 19th century Grade II cast iron structure, inscribed DERBY/4/MILES, and with the name of the makers up the shaft, HARRISON. (2)
